- [ ] **Step 7: Breaker override escrow.** After sealing the signing keys for the Tallgrove upstream API circuit breaker, confirm the support team can force the breaker open during a full outage. The override bundle lives in the sealed escrow drawer and is useless without its unlock phrase. Two ceremony witnesses must initial this step before proceeding. The escrow bundle is decrypted with the recovery passphrase that follows.

vault phrase of kahip-kahop = holath-quenmir

Handover note — Payline integration tests

The flaky suite in Payline's settlement service is mostly timing-related: three tests race against the mock clearing house and fail roughly one run in five. I've quarantined them behind a retry wrapper, but that's a stopgap, not a fix. Proper deflaking is scheduled for next cycle. The engineer accountable for that work is named below.

named custodian: Zorok Briir Novvan

// CATALOGUE_IMPORT_CHUNK_SIZE
//
// Controls how many records the Merribrook Library feed is
// split into per transaction. Welcome aboard — please keep
// this at 250 unless the Halvorsen ingest team approves a
// change, since larger chunks trip the dedupe timeout. The
// approved baseline was certified under the build token below.

build token for kajeg-bageg: htk6_abeb3e